Trey Benson Goes On Injured Reserve

By Shane Hallam | Updated on Tue, 31 Dec 2024, 6:18 PM EST
Trey Benson Headshot

Cardinals RB Trey Benson has been placed on Injured Reserve with an ankle injury, so he will not be playing in Week 18. With RB James Conner battling a knee injury, Benson had a chance to start and potentially go off heading into the 2025 season. Instead, Michael Carter will likely start if Conner is out.

What They're Saying

Howard Balzer of CardsWire: "Cardinals placed RB Trey Benson on injured reserve, signed OL Nick Leverett from practice squad to active roster and signed RB Hassan Hall to the practice squad."

2024 Fantasy Football Impact

Benson had a disappointing rookie season but will enter 2025 as the primary handcuff to Conner.

If your championship is in Week 18, Carter is worth a stash and potential flex play.
